Re: Post Your Mileage
2004 GT1 just passed 150000km (93000mi) no mods. Converter replaced @ 88km due to a p420 code (emission warranty),Valve seals replaced @ 126km under extended warranty due to excessive oil burning (probably the cause of the bad converter). No other major problems, just the usual (wheel bearings, steering shaft clunk and evap canister purge solenoid). I plan to get at least 300km out of it.
